  • In addition to safety, fire-resistant electrical tape can increase the longevity of electrical connections. Regular electrical tape may degrade over time, especially under extreme conditions, leading to insulation failures. The durability of fire-resistant tape means it can withstand harsher conditions, thereby extending the lifespan of electrical installations.

    2. Polyethylene film tape (63507) is a 7-mil thick, low-density polyethylene tape coated on one side with a synthetic rubber adhesive that stays permanently tacky. This tape bonds well through a wide range of temperatures and has a particularly good bonding ability at low temperatures. It is conformable, waterproof, tear-resistant, and chemical resistant.

    14. Fire seal tape is an intumescent material, meaning it expands when exposed to heat. This unique property allows the tape to seal joints and gaps in walls, floors, and ceilings, preventing smoke and flames from spreading between compartments. Commonly made from materials like silicone or other fire-resistant compounds, fire seal tape can withstand high temperatures and maintain its integrity under extreme conditions.


    15. Firstly, door intumescent strips are the most common type. These are installed around the edges of doors and frames, expanding upon exposure to high temperatures, ensuring that fire and smoke are contained within the room of origin. They not only provide fire resistance but also enhance acoustic and weatherproofing properties.
